Files
kontor/kontor-api/Makefile
2025-04-30 22:11:48 +02:00

15 lines
332 B
Makefile

.PHONY: clean virtualenv test docker
clean:
find . -name '*.py[co]' -delete
test:
DB_SERVER=localhost uv run pytest -v --cov --cov-report=term --cov-report=html:coverage-report
docker: clean
docker build --target=production -t kontor-api:0.2.0-SNAPSHOT .
dev:
DB_SERVER=127.0.0.1 uv run fastapi dev src/main.py --port 8008